Scientific notation definition

Mathematics
2 answers:
Grace [21]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Scientific notation is a way of expressing numbers that are too large or too small to be conveniently written in decimal form.

Some equations have the form y=kx, where k is a number. Which equation CANNOT be written in the form y=kx?
kumpel [21]

Answer:

Any equation of the form

y = kx + b,

with b different from zero

Step-by-step explanation:

For example

y = 5*x +3

cannot be written in the form

y = k*x, because there is a term that shifts the graph upwards.
